SYMPTOMS
========

When you use the Run= line in the WIN.INI file to start a windowed MS-DOS
application followed by a Windows application, the keyboard input goes to the
MS-DOS application. The focus remains on the MS-DOS application in the
background and does not switch to the Windows application in the foreground as
you would expect. This only happens in 386 enhanced mode.

The following is a sample WIN.INI run line:

       Run=word.pif winword.exe

WORKAROUND
==========

To switch the focus to the Windows application in the foreground, click anywhere
in the Windows application with the mouse. If you do not have a mouse, press
ALT+ESC.
